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
View Source
var ( Grafana = component.BasicComponent{ Name: "grafana", Source: "grafana", Type: "HelmRelease", Scope: "Observability", DependsOn: []meta.NamespacedObjectReference{ { Name: "postgres-zalando", }, { Name: "postgres-libresh", }, }, AdminCreds: true, } Loki = component.BasicComponent{ Name: "loki", Source: "grafana", Type: "HelmRelease", Scope: "Observability", DependsOn: []meta.NamespacedObjectReference{ { Name: "object-storage-operator", }, }, AdminCreds: true, } Promtail = component.BasicComponent{ Name: "promtail", Source: "grafana", Type: "HelmRelease", Scope: "Observability", DependsOn: []meta.NamespacedObjectReference{ { Name: "loki", }, }, } PrometheusStack = component.BasicComponent{ Name: "prometheus-stack", Source: "prometheus-community", Type: "HelmRelease", Scope: "Observability", DependsOn: []meta.NamespacedObjectReference{ { Name: "object-storage-operator", }, { Name: "thanos", }, }, } Thanos = component.BasicComponent{ Name: "thanos", Source: "bitnami", Type: "HelmRelease", Scope: "Observability", DependsOn: []meta.NamespacedObjectReference{ { Name: "object-storage-operator", }, }, } )
Functions ¶
This section is empty.
Types ¶
type Model ¶
type Model struct { /* components []string manager *ssa.ResourceManager done *bool */ *component.ScopeModel }
func (Model) Components ¶
Click to show internal directories.
Click to hide internal directories.